ENGLISH u u u Hold power tool by insulated gripping surfaces when performing an operation where the fastener may contact hidden wiring. Fasteners contacting a "live" wire may make exposed metal parts of the power tool "live" and could give the operator an electric shock. Use clamps or another practical way to secure and support the workpiece to a stable platform. Holding the work by hand or against your body leaves it unstable and may lead to loss of control.

ENGLISH (Original instructions) Electrical safety # u Your charger is double insulated; therefore no earth wire is required. Always check that the mains voltage corresponds to the voltage on the rating plate. Never attempt to replace the charger unit with a regular mains plug. If the supply cord is damaged, it must be replaced by the manufacturer or an authorised Black & Decker Service Centre in order to avoid a hazard. (Original instructions) The charger may hum and become warm while charging; this is normal and does not indicate a problem. Warning! Do not charge the battery at ambient temperatures below 10 °C or above 40 °C. Recommended charging temperature: approx. 24 °C. ENGLISH (Original instructions) Hints for optimum use Screwdriving u Always use the correct type and size of screwdriver bit. u If screws are difficult to tighten, try applying a small amount of washing liquid or soap as a lubricant. u Always hold the tool and screwdriver bit in a straight line with the screw.
